3. RES# of pin 4 of the H-UDI port connector is a signal line in which the emulator
outputs signals to the MCU. RES# of pin 4 and the user system reset circuit must be
connected to the MCU, as shown in figure 1.6. RES# of pin 7 of the H-UDI port
connector is a signal line in which the emulator monitors the RES# signal of the MCU.
The RES# must be pulled up before it is connected to pin 7 of the H-UDI port
connector.

4. Connect GND of pins 8 to 10 and 12 to 14 of the H-UDI port connector to ground in
the user system.
5. Connect Vcc, pin 11 of the H-UDI port connector, to the power supply (Vcc) in the
user system. The input voltage, Vcc, is within the range of guaranteed operation of
the microcomputer.
6. Figure 1.7 shows the interface circuit in the emulator. Use this figure as a reference
when determining the pull-up resistance value.
